: Health Maintenance Organization (HMO) plans usually require a formal referral from your primary care physician, while Preferred Provider Organization (PPO) plans typically do not.

: Evaluations and spinal adjustments for diagnosable pain or dysfunction (like lower back pain or neck pain) are usually covered. buy chiropractic insurance
: Your provider must establish a paper trail documenting your initial exam, diagnosis, treatment plan, and measurable progress.
